- Thu Aug 24, 2006 1:45 pm
- Forum: Finishing
- Topic: Wood Filler for screw holes
- Replies: 14
- Views: 14340
I used ramen dowels 3/16" , drilled the old holes out with a 3/16" bradpoint bit with a depth stop, cut dowels to length on bandsaw rounded one end on sander, mixed small batch of epoxy stirred the dowels in epoxy and tapped in hole... the ramen is supposed to be a tropical wood like mahogany, the 3...
